The PVC syncer's translateSelector and the PV syncer's translate call translate.Default.HostNameCluster() directly for volumeName and storageClassName, bypassing the PV and SC mappers. This unconditionally mangles these names even for PVs synced from the host (with the vcluster.loft.sh/host-pv annotation), making it impossible to bind a PVC to a pre-existing host PV by name. It also causes SC name mismatches between PVs and PVCs on the host when toHost.storageClasses.enabled is false (mirror mapper scenario). Route the 5 call sites through mappings.VirtualToHostName() so translation respects resource origin — host-synced resources retain their original names, vCluster-created resources are still translated.

Align PV storageClass mapping with Sync reconcile logic
With sync.toHost.storageClasses.enabled=false, this new call resolves through the StorageClass mirror mapper and keeps the original class name, but persistentvolumes/syncer.go still forces translate.Default.HostNameCluster(...) in Sync (event.Host.Spec.StorageClassName at lines 249-251). That makes the create path and steady-state reconcile path disagree for the same PV, and after this commit PVC translation now also keeps the unmodified class, so host PV/PVC storage class names can diverge and prevent binding (or cause repeated reconcile attempts if the field update is rejected).

The Sync reconcile path in persistentvolumes/syncer.go still called translate.Default.HostNameCluster() for StorageClassName, while the create path and the PVC syncer now route through mappings.StorageClasses(). When sync.toHost.storageClasses.enabled=false the mapper is a mirror and keeps the original name, so the create and reconcile paths would disagree on the same PV — causing host PV/PVC class names to diverge or repeated reconcile attempts if the update was rejected.

What does this pull request do? Which issues does it resolve?
The PVC syncer's translateSelector function calls translate.Default.HostNameCluster() directly to translate volumeName and storageClassName, bypassing the PV and SC mappers. This unconditionally mangles these names even when the PV was synced from the host (has vcluster.loft.sh/host-pv annotation), making it impossible to bind a PVC to a pre-existing host PV by name.
Additionally, the PV syncer's translate function has the same pattern for storageClassName, causing SC name mismatches between PVs and PVCs on the host when toHost.storageClasses.enabled is false.
This fix replaces 5 instances of HostNameCluster() with mappings.VirtualToHostName() across 2 files, routing through the proper mappers which conditionally translate based on resource origin — host-synced resources retain their original names, vCluster-created resources still get translated normally.
resolves #3810
Please provide a short message that should be published in the vcluster release notes
Fixed an issue where vCluster unconditionally mangled volumeName and storageClassName when syncing PVCs to the host, even for PVs synced from the host with the vcluster.loft.sh/host-pv annotation. PVCs with explicit volumeName pointing to a pre-existing host PV now bind correctly.
What else do we need to know?
The PV mapper (pkg/mappings/resources/persistentvolumes.go:18-29) already had the correct annotation-aware logic — this fix simply ensures the PVC and PV syncers use it instead of bypassing it.
The fix also addresses the PV syncer's storageClassName translation (persistentvolumes/translate.go:20) to prevent SC name mismatches between PVs and PVCs on the host when toHost.storageClasses.enabled is false (mirror mapper scenario).
